European Space Agency
MEMBERSHIP DETAILS
The European Space Agency (ESA) has 22 member states, 20 of which are in the EU and two of which are not – Norway and Switzerland. The UK's membership does not, therefore, depend on it remaining in the EU and, indeed, there are also two non-full members, Canada and Slovenia.
